Are you passionate about software engineering? Do you enjoy problem-solving and working collaboratively to achieve great results?
We're looking for a talented individual to join our team of researchers, developers, engineers, designers and entrepreneurs.
As a key member of our team, you will be responsible for developing software projects on behalf of customers and conducting research and development for our own software products and services.
Your Key Responsibilities
* Design and implementation of software components, products and services from analysis and development to deployment and rollout
* Evaluation and analysis of new and existing technologies, frameworks and tooling for productive use in software development
* Continuous improvement of quality through relentless root-cause analysis, detailed code reviews, thorough documentation, testing, learning and debugging
Your Qualifications
* Degree in computer science with above-average grades (preferably M.Sc., diploma or PhD) or similar qualification
* Several years of practical experience in designing and developing software, preferably as part of a development team
* Strong problem-solving and decision-making skills with good judgment and appreciation for feedback to develop and grow